Output e6fbd26ad8524072c2ea2a7fcf0cf4e3d912fd7e6d6870da7b1fefbf3b40066c:0

value
6381973
script pubkey
OP_0 OP_PUSHBYTES_20 66dba7e87643224bc192cac550cfd8345a045bba
address
bc1qvmd606rkgv3yhsvjetz4pn7cx3dqgka67zmgr6
transaction
e6fbd26ad8524072c2ea2a7fcf0cf4e3d912fd7e6d6870da7b1fefbf3b40066c
confirmations
350762
spent
true